USAGE SUMMARY

Employee evaluations is correct and is usable in written English.
You can use it when describing a process in which employees are provided feedback on their performance in a particular job. For example: "All employees must undergo bi-annual employee evaluations to ensure their work meets the standards of the company."

FAQs

What are some other terms for "employee evaluations"?

Alternatives include "performance reviews", "staff appraisals", or "personnel assessments", each with slight variations in emphasis.

How are "employee evaluations" used to improve performance?

"Employee evaluations" provide feedback on strengths and weaknesses, helping employees focus on development areas. They also inform decisions about promotions and training opportunities.

Which is more formal, "employee evaluations" or "performance reviews"?

"Employee evaluations" and "performance reviews" are often used interchangeably. However, "employee evaluations" might suggest a slightly more formal and structured process.

What makes "employee evaluations" effective?

Effective "employee evaluations" are based on clear criteria, provide specific examples, and offer constructive feedback. They should also be a two-way conversation, allowing employees to share their perspectives.
